define product development
the process of creating or modifying a products-.
effective and efficient product development ensures what for the company?
- new products are consistent with insurers overall strategic marketing objectives
- NP serve designated taget markets appropriately
- company does not waste its resources on unsuccessful new products
- new products generate enough revenue to pay associates benefits and expenses as well as return a modest profit to company owners

name the basic 5 steps of product development
product planing comprehensive business analysis technical design product implementation perfomance monitoring and review
At the end of the first 3 steps senior management will determine what?
wheter to
- continue the development of the BP,
- request additional informaiton or revision to the product idea
- drop the new product idea
what are the 3 basic activities of product planing?
idea generation
screening
concept development/testing
define idea generation when it comes to product planing
involves searching for new product ideas that are consistent with the companys overall product developement strategy and the needs of its target markets.
do companies stress over creativity or technical details for new product ideas during idea generation?
creativity
define screening when it comes to product planing
a weeding out process designed to evaluate ate new product ideas quickly and inexpensively and to select those ideas that warrant futher investigation.
what would a project team look at when screening for new products?
- compatible with company’s corporate goals and existing systems and distribution channels
- satisfies a real need in the target markets inw hich the company operates
- replaces slaes of exsitating products instead of generating new sales.
define concept testing when it comes to product planing
its a maketing reseach technique desgined to measure the acceptability of new product ideas, new promotion campaigns or other new marketing elements before entering productions.

What is a comprehensive business analysis?
where the company conducts research to determine how feasible and marketable a proposed product is.
what 5 elements are included in a comprehensive business analysis?
- market analysis
- product design objectives
- feasibility study
- marketing plan
- marketing projections
what is market analysis
an evaluations of all the environmental factors that might affect product sales.
define product design objectives
specify an insurance product’s basic characteristic features. Serves as a guideline for the technical design step of the product development process.
what is a feasibility study?
research designed to determine, from an operational and technical viewpoint
- how viable it would be for the company to produce and offer the product
- hor the new product would impact the company’s existing products.
what are marketing projections?
preliminary sales and financial forcasts that include extimates of potential unit sales, revenue, costs and profits for a proposed product.
-helps determine how finanically viable a new product will be.

define product implementation
establishing the admin structures and processes needed to introduce a product into the marketplace.
what 3 concurrent activities are included in the implementation of products?
- obtaining necessary regulatory approvals
- designing promotions and training materials
- developing and implying all information systems and procedures necessary to market and administer the product.
